Join HOSPICE UK as the Clinical Director to shape palliative and end‑of‑life care in West Kent and East Sussex. You will provide strategic leadership, ensuring services are safe and person‑centred while leading innovation in quality assurance.
The ideal candidate is a registered nurse or medical practitioner with senior experience in hospice care, capable of inspiring teams and fostering relationships with NHS partners to improve patient outcomes.
